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89842572421 1055631644 3942
81 6909366154 41356349514
81 6909366154 41356349514
32788035 177619678 0068 1790991349
All about undefined
Interested in learning more?
81 6909366154 41356349514
32788035 177619678 0068 1790991349
See more
010940 45626342717 340271
36403615 6760 0332279122 73
See more
2845155 72556859 128
15705 75325 394 698
See more